Democrats start effort to loosen abortion laws in Virginia
RICHMOND Virginia Democrats on Wednesday began to dismantle abortion restrictions erected by Republicans over the past decade, pushing an omnibus bill to the House floor on a 12-to-9 party-line vote.
The bill would expand the categories of health professionals who can perform abortions, remove requirements for ultrasounds and waiting periods and eliminate rules that made some clinics ineligible to perform the procedure.
Having advanced gun-control bills and passed the Equal Rights Amendment in the past week, Democrats turned their attention to abortion on the 47th anniversary of Roe v. Wade, the Supreme Court decision that legalized the procedure nationwide.
With control of the governors mansion and both legislative chambers for the first time in 26 years, Democratic lawmakers expect to be able to roll back numerous abortion restrictions, including a requirement that clinics performing more than a few abortions per month meet hospital-level standards for their buildings.
